Loading and stowing
201
Telescopic rod
1
Telescopic rod
2 Mounting element
i The telescopic rod can be used to secure
the load against the rear seats to prevent it
from moving around.
X Insert one mounting element 2into each
loading rail.
X Turn mounting elements 2in the loading
rail to N.
X Insert telescopic rod 1into mounting ele-
ments 2.
X Turn mounting element 2to‹ until
you feel it clearly engage in loading rail. Stowage compartments
G
Risk of injury
The stowage compartments must be closed
when items are stored in them. Luggage
nets are not designed to secure heavy
items of luggage.
You or other vehicle occupants could be
injured by objects being thrown around if
you:
R brake sharply
R change direction suddenly
R are involved in an accident
Sharp-edged and fragile objects must not
be placed in the luggage net.
i You will find an overview of the stowage
compartments on (Y page 36).
Glove compartment i
Depending on the vehicle's equipment,
there is an AUX-IN connection installed in
the glove compartment, or a Media Inter-
face*, which is a universal interface for
portable audio equipment, e.g. for an iPod
or USB device. 1
Handle
2 Cover
The glove compartment can be locked and
unlocked using the emergency key element
(Y page 308).
X To open: pull handle 1in the direction of
the arrow and fold down cover 2.
X To close: fold cover 2upwards until it
engages. Controls

255First-aid kit
i Check the expiry date of the first-aid kit
annually, and replace the contents when
necessary.
The first-aid kit is located behind the side trim
in the luggage compartment. 1
First-aid kit
X Open the side trim (Y page 318).
X Remove first-aid kit 1. Fire extinguisher*
i Have the fire extinguisher refilled after
each use and checked every one or two
years. Otherwise, it may fail in an emer-
gency.
Observe the legal requirements in all coun-
tries concerned.
The fire extinguisher is located underneath
the front of the driver's seat. 1
Tab
2 Fire extinguisher
X Pull tab 1upwards.
X Remove fire extinguisher 2. Vehicle tool kit, TIREFIT, jack, spare
wheel* and emergency spare wheel*
The vehicle tool kit, TIREFIT kit, jack and
emergency spare wheel* are in a stowage
space under the luggage compartment floor.
X Open the luggage compartment floor
(Y page 254).
The vehicle tool kit contains:
R a towing eye
R a wheel wrench
R a folding wheel chock
R a pair of gloves
The spare wheel* is in the exterior spare
wheel bracket* (Y page 256). G
Risk of injury
The jack is designed only to raise and hold
the vehicle for a short time while a wheel
is being changed.
If you are carrying out work on the vehicle,
you must use stands.
Make sure that the jack is placed on a firm,
non-slip and level surface. Do not use
wooden blocks or similar objects as a jack

Setting up the foldable wheel chock The folding wheel chock serves as an addi-
tional measure for securing the vehicleagainst rolling away, e.g. when a wheel is
being changed.
1
To fold the plates upwards
2 To fold out the lower plate
3 To insert the plate
X Fold both plates 1upwards.
X Fold out lower plate 2.
X Guide the lugs on the lower plate fully into
the openings in base plate 3.Practical advice
